Chevy retools Equinox with better fuel economy, modern touches | detnews.com | The Detroit News
The 2010 Chevrolet Equinox -- facing stiff competition in the compact crossover segment -- will take on a more trucky look and come with a more fuel efficient engine when it is redesigned for the 2010 model year. General Motors Corp. officially took the wraps off of the new Equinox on Sunday and will introduce the next generation family hauler at the North American International Auto Show in Detroit in January. Honda announces lithium-ion battery venture
Honda has delivered some good news after disappointing its high-performance fans this morning when it announced that it has suspended plans to built the 2010 Honda NSX. The Japanese automaker announced today that it has found a partner for lithium-ion battery development - Japan’s GS Yuasa Corp.CEO Takeo Fukui said today that Honda will team up with GS Yuasa Corp. to manufacture next-generation lithium-ion batteries for Honda’s future hybrid vehicles. Honda reduces its yearly operating profit estimate by 67%
On Wednesday Honda reduced its yearly operating profit estimate by 67 percent, its third profit caution this year, as a deepening financial emergency continues to hit international vehicle demand and making the yen soar. The second-biggest carmaker of Japan now anticipates operating profit for the fiscal year to March 31 at 180 billion yen or $2 billion, about 81 percent fall from the previous year.
